This patent describes an improved airship (blimp or zeppelin) design featuring at least three (preferably four) propulsion units distributed around the balloon envelope. The arrangement and independent control of the motors allow the generation and shifting of force and torque vectors at varied points, enabling precise control to largely prevent the airship from oscillating or tilting due to external disturbances like wind.

Patent Abstract
The invention relates to an airship comprising a balloon and several drives for displacing the airship. Said invention can be used by dirigibles that are also known as autonomous airships or blimps, as well as for Zeppelins. The aim of the invention is to provide an airship of the above-mentioned type in which the airship can be prevented to a large extent from oscillating or tilting. Said aim is achieved as the drives of the airship are at least three drives and are arranged about the balloon in such a manner that a force vector or a torque vector generated by the drives can be produced thus varying the position thereof.
